地球日、API 和阳光。

Avatar of Robin Rendle
Robin Rendle

DigitalOcean 为您旅程的每个阶段提供云产品。立即开始使用 $200 免费信用额度!

Cassie Evans 展示了一些非常巧妙的网页设计理念,并探索了使用 Clearleft 团队最近聘请的为其大楼屋顶安装太阳能板的公司提供的 API。Cassie 概述了她设计一个 使用 API 的网页 的旅程,该网页用于填充一些关于该大楼在安装太阳能板后使用的能源的轻量级数据可视化。

在这里,在 Clearleft,我们一直在采取小措施来减少我们的环境影响。在 2018 年 12 月,我们用太阳能板覆盖了我们家的屋顶。

随着第一缕灿烂的夏日阳光开始照耀在我们身上,我们开始思考它们在过去 5 个月里对环境的影响。

幸运的是,我们的太阳能板有一个 API,因此我们不仅可以找到这些信息,还可以从 SolarEdge 请求这些信息并在我们自己的界面中显示出来。

这篇文章是对使用 Fetch API 的一个很好的实际观察,也是 Zell Liew 详细写过的内容,涵盖了使用 JavaScript 与 API 交互的历史、处理错误以及在使用 API 时可能会发生的各种奇怪问题。

但是,同样有趣和有用的是阅读 Cassie 在为页面绘制线框图、研究如何使用 Fetch API 以及将动画集成到可爱的 SVG 插图时的思考过程。这是一种许多人可以体会到并从中学习的设计和开发练习。

哦,说到数据可视化,Dan Englishby 今天在 将数据导入图表的方法 上发布了一些内容。与实时 API 的合作也在其中涵盖,并且是 Cassie 文章的良好衔接。

直接链接 →